What is the Jeep Badge of Honor

A Digital Passport




The Jeep Badge of Honor app is an official mobile application designed by Jeep to celebrate the off-roading lifestyle. It enables Jeep owners to explore new trails, document their adventures, and earn badges for tackling off-road terrains. It's a digital passport for your off-roading journeys. 




The Jeep Badge of Honor app boasts an impressive selection of trails. As of now, there are over 68 trails listed, with new ones added periodically. These trails are scattered across the U.S., covering a variety of terrains from rugged mountains to sandy deserts.

Once you complete the trail Jeep will send you a badge you can display on your Jeep. They become conversation pieces. 

How to Use the Jeep Badge of Honor App



Getting started with the Jeep Badge of Honor app is easy.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ate the app like a pro:


Download the App: Available on both iOS and Android, just search for "Jeep Badge of Honor" in your app store.

Create an Account: Sign up using your email or social media accounts. Make sure to input your Jeep model details.

Explore Trails: Browse through the list of trails across the United States. Each trail is rated for difficulty, and you can see photos and reviews from other Jeepers.

Check-In: When you hit the trail, use the app to check in. Your phone's GPS verifies your location, making it easy to prove you’ve tackled the trail.

Earn Badges: Completing trails earns you digital badges. Then Jeep will mail you the physical badges to proudly display on your vehicle.

What is a Sway Bar?

A sway bar, also known as an anti-roll bar or stabilizer bar, is a part of a vehicle's suspension system. It's a long, torsion-resistant bar that connects the left and right wheels through short lever arms linked by a bar. The primary purpose of a sway bar is to reduce body roll during cornering or when driving over uneven terrain.



How Does a Sway Bar Work?

When you take a turn or drive over rough terrain, your vehicle's body tends to roll to one side due to centrifugal force. The sway bar counteracts this force by transferring some of the load to the opposite side of the vehicle. This process helps keep all four wheels in contact with the ground, providing better stability and handling.

Importance of a Sway Bar in Off-Roading

Off-roading is all about tackling challenging terrains and obstacles. Here's why a sway bar is vital in this context:

  1. Improved Stability: Off-road trails are often uneven and unpredictable. A sway bar helps maintain stability by minimizing body roll, which is essential when navigating steep inclines, declines, and side slopes.

  2. Enhanced Handling: Better handling means more control over your vehicle. A sway bar ensures that your Jeep remains responsive to steering inputs, which is crucial when maneuvering through tight trails or rocky paths.

  3. Safety: Off-roading can be risky, and safety should always be a top priority. By keeping your vehicle more stable and reducing the likelihood of rollovers, a sway bar plays a significant role in ensuring your safety on the trails.

  4. Comfort: While off-roading is often about the thrill, comfort shouldn't be ignored. A sway bar helps provide a smoother ride by keeping your vehicle more level, which can reduce driver fatigue and improve the overall off-roading experience.

Sway Bar Disconnects: A Game Changer for Jeep Owners

Many off-road enthusiasts, particularly Jeep owners, opt for sway bar disconnects. These allow you to disengage the sway bar when off-roading and reconnect it for on-road driving. The benefits are twofold:

  1. Increased Articulation: Disconnecting the sway bar increases wheel articulation, allowing your Jeep's wheels to move more independently. This flexibility is invaluable when navigating obstacles like rocks, tree roots, and deep ruts.

  2. Versatility: Sway bar disconnects provide the best of both worlds. You can enjoy enhanced stability and handling on the road, and when you hit the trails, you can disconnect the sway bar for maximum off-road performance.
